Here is my first stab at modelling Triceratops horridus, probably the most iconic and FUN dinosaurs going. I have tried to keep the body proportions accurate to the reconstructions of the fossil skeletons. the number of toes (always important! 8-) ) is correct as is the arrangement of ankles, knees, wrists and elbows. I cannot guarantee that the eye or body colours are at all accurate…

anyway, you need:

  • 100g DK yarn in the colour of your choice for the body
  • roughly 10g of whatever colour you think the horns should be
  • another 10g or so for the beak and toes
  • stuffing material

Bearing in mind that the neck frill was probably for social display rather than actual defense, there is no reason why you shouldn’t develop your own pattern of colours for the frill. Let me know how you get on!
